Level 7 Diploma in Facility Management: A career in Facility Management offers diverse opportunities within the UK's thriving job market. The following roles highlight the diverse skill sets required in this dynamic field.
Facilities Manager: This senior-level role demands strategic thinking and leadership in overseeing all aspects of a building's operation. Excellent communication and problem-solving skills are essential for this high-demand position, aligning with the core competencies of a Level 7 Diploma.
Building Services Engineer: With expertise in HVAC, electrical systems, and plumbing, this crucial role ensures the efficient and safe operation of building infrastructure. Strong technical skills and a deep understanding of building regulations are key for this vital position within the facility management sector.
Sustainability Manager: Increasingly important in today’s market, this role focuses on implementing environmentally friendly practices and reducing a building's carbon footprint. A background in sustainability and knowledge of relevant legislation are vital components of this increasingly sought-after facility management role.
Health & Safety Officer: Ensuring a safe and compliant workplace is paramount. This role demands a deep understanding of health and safety regulations and the ability to implement and monitor safety protocols. It is a crucial role within the realm of facility management.
Key facts about Level 7 Diploma in Facility Management
A Level 7 Diploma in Facility Management provides advanced knowledge and skills crucial for a successful career in the facilities management sector.
The program's learning outcomes typically include strategic facility planning, financial management within facilities, and legal compliance related to building operations.
You'll gain expertise in areas such as risk assessment, sustainability practices, and contract negotiation, all vital components of effective facility management.
The duration of the Level 7 Diploma in Facility Management varies depending on the institution and study mode, usually ranging from one to two years.
This qualification is highly relevant to the current industry landscape, preparing graduates for leadership roles in corporate real estate, healthcare facilities, and various other sectors requiring expert facility management.
Graduates often find employment as facility managers, operations managers, or project managers, demonstrating the program's significant career impact.
The curriculum often integrates current best practices, emerging technologies, and industry standards in building maintenance and operations management, ensuring high employability.
Upon successful completion, you'll possess a comprehensive understanding of integrated facility management (IFM) principles and their practical application.
The advanced level of this diploma provides a solid foundation for professional certification and continuous professional development, enhancing long-term career prospects within facilities management.
